We develop and deliver nationally-recognized adult education … WebApr 5, 2024 · Safety footwear is designed to protect feet against a wide variety of injuries. Impact, compression, and puncture are the most common types of foot injury. Choose footwear according to the hazard. Refer to CSA Standard Z195-14 (R2024) "Protective footwear" or other standards that are required in your jurisdiction. WebProduct Details.
